billy123 01-04-2016 01:38 PM

In Derbyshire you have your:

Breakfast (in the morning obviously)
Dinner (mid day)
Tea (evening meal 5-7pm)
Supper (a bit of a snack late at night before bedtime)

Nowt posh about having your tea.
